Description

A breathtaking new vision of a legendary tale. Snow White is the only person in the land fairer than the evil queen who is out to destroy her. But in a twist to the fairytale, the Huntsman ordered to take Snow White into the woods to be killed becomes her protector and mentor in a quest to vanquish the Evil Queen.   • So this is another fairy tale book based off a movie, but it's an interesting story (still haven't watched the movie) and not a bad read. In this version we're given a glimpse into the perspective of Snow White, the Queen, and the Huntsman who has been sent to kill Snow White. We see the ugly side of beauty and we see a Snow White who takes her future into her own hands.
